Kostya was one of the finest exponents of 'The Art' when it came to handling southpaws. A simple rule he followed was keeping his left foot on the outside of his oponents rightfoot, therefore taking away the chance of a southpaw landing right hands with a great deal of power. Tszyu dropped many southpaws with single right hand shots. He had dynamite in that punch. 'Sweet Pea" enjoyed mixing it up, at close range, and demonstrating his clever array of punching and infighting evasiveness.
